What Makes The Gorilla Glue Strain So Special?
Gorilla Glue (We've Got the OG Gorilla Glue #4) is the result of a powerful cross between Chem’s Sister, Sour Dubb, and Chocolate Diesel—three strains known for potency and complexity. It rose to fame for one major reason: resin. Gorilla Glue became instantly recognizable for its heavy trichome coverage, with buds so sticky they earned the name “glue.” Its knockout strength, pungent aroma, and signature frost made it a staple on dispensary menus and a go-to for those chasing strong, sedative effects with visual appeal.

What is THCa flower?
+
THCa flower is cannabis that’s high in tetrahydrocannabinolic acid (THCa), the raw, non-psychoactive form of THC. When heated (through smoking, vaping, or cooking), THCa converts into Delta‑9 THC—the compound responsible for the “high” in cannabis.

Is THCa Flower Legal?
+
Yes. Under the 2018 Farm Bill, hemp is legal if it contains less than 0.3% Delta‑9 THC by dry weight. THCa itself is not restricted at the federal level, meaning high-THCa flower is legal as long as it meets that Delta‑9 threshold before being heated.

Does THCa Get You High?
+
Not in its raw form. THCa is non-psychoactive until it’s heated. Once decarboxylated (via smoking or vaping), it converts to Delta‑9 THC and delivers effects nearly identical to traditional cannabis flower.

Will It Show Up On A Drug Test?
+
Yes. Once consumed, THCa converts into Delta‑9 THC, which can trigger a positive result on drug screenings that test for THC metabolites.
